Output 34bd05668ea0d8694e5760993dbc4fb43fd57e89b5f050d7e589941e59ac66bf:0

value
1058576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52fa38fe81e55947db42c80fe3c5df38a50af037 OP_EQUAL
address
39Fm63h5twNcMj8TJWtfhH4886F1P6mk9r
transaction
34bd05668ea0d8694e5760993dbc4fb43fd57e89b5f050d7e589941e59ac66bf